Zurich - the final goodbye to Switzerland

So I will keep this short because I’m having to write this on my phone. After a short overnight stay at Bolligen (where I lived for a short while when I was 10) it was on to Zurich. Zurich is a beautiful city and the friend I stayed with was great company - we walked all around the city talking about what everything. He is an architect so we went to a building by the Swiss architect Le Corbusier and I got the ‘architectural’ insights which made it all the better. I was only in Zurich for a weekend but it was a good weekend with lots of exploring. I went to the main art gallery which was huge with some excellent paintings and also visited the Grossmunster with stunning contemporary stained glass windows and the Fraumunster with windows created by Chagall. 

Over the weekend we talked about so many things and it was interesting to see how the Swiss live. I am struck how advanced the Swiss are on environmental issues and how much better they are at managing their resources. Their infrastructure is also excellent - it would be very easy to live here without a car and live more simply. My time in Zurich was a nice way to end my time in Switzerland as I head to Croatia…
